Zuckerberg’s Defense: Justifying the Instagram Acquisition and Dismissing Monopoly Concerns
In a recent testimony, Mark Zuckerberg, the CEO of Meta, defended the acquisition of Instagram, a photo-sharing app, for $1 billion in 2012. Zuckerberg claimed that taking Instagram off the market and building their own version of it was “a reasonable thing to do” to neutralize the threat posed by the platform’s rapid growth. This statement reflects a common argument made by Meta in the ongoing Meta monopoly trial, which alleges that the company bought Instagram and WhatsApp to squash competition and establish an illegal monopoly in the social media market.
However, Kevin Systrom, Instagram’s co-founder, has accused Zuckerberg of stifling Instagram’s growth due to his allegiances to Facebook. Systrom testified that Facebook resources were diverted away from Instagram, and he received no additional staffing for video tools, which he claimed was an unacceptable and offensive outcome.
Zuckerberg’s defense hinges on the idea that acquiring Instagram was necessary to prevent a “network collapse” at Facebook. This theory is supported by a confidential email from Zuckerberg in 2018, which suggested that Instagram’s growth was contributing to a decline in Facebook’s daily active users. Systrom corroborated this theory, stating that Facebook’s US daily active users experienced dramatic softness, and Zuckerberg and Meta executive Chris Cox believed that Instagram’s growth was the primary cause.

The Meta Monopoly Trial: Examining the Allegations and Potential Consequences
The ongoing Meta monopoly trial has significant implications for the social media landscape, with the potential for Meta to be broken up into separate entities, including Instagram and WhatsApp. This would have far-reaching consequences for the social media market, with the potential for increased competition and innovation.
The lawsuit, filed against Meta in 2020, alleges that the company bought Instagram and WhatsApp to squash competition and establish an illegal monopoly in the social media market. The trial has seen testimony from key figures, including Kevin Systrom, Instagram’s co-founder, who has accused Zuckerberg of stifling Instagram’s growth.
